Bioware has released a new promotional video for its upcoming ‘not-Destiny’ game Anthem, showing off its botanical prowess with, uh, a maize maze. Bioware has sponsored its home city’s corn maze, which has resulted in a huge Anthem exosuit being carved into the field of maize. For some reason

The dev has crafted a huge design showing off the Bioware company logo alongside the 50 foot exosuit. I’ve no idea how many folks will wander through the fields of corn, appreciating the work of the game dev, but it’d be good to have a gander at the very least.

Since most of us won’t be able to appreciate this first-hand, Bioware has put out a video showcasing its love of nature, replete with kernels of corn filtering through fingers.
